Description: Dash is an eight year old grade Tennessee walker gelding. This stylish gelding stands 15 hands on shoes. Dash has been trail ridden and isn’t spooky nor jumpy. He has an excellent gait with a little head bob. He will walk or bump up to a gait, no problem. He has an off button but plenty of go, making him good minded. Step on or step off, this gelding will stand and wait for you to be ready. He has never offered to buck, rear, bite, or kick. Dash stands to be tied, bathed, clipped, groomed, tacked or un-tacked, fly sprayed, for the farrier, and cross-tied. He crosses creeks, ditches, logs, road bridges, wooden bridges, and tarps. He is desensitized to trash bags, whips, tarps, dogs, and cars. He started right with groundwork. Dash is not mean or stubborn. He will stand tied, ride, or eat with any horse. Dash rides alone or in a group. He is soft in the face, giving to pressure and not pushy on the bit. Dash rides in a offset d-ring or jr. cow horse bit! He rides anywhere you point him, being reliable.
If you want a gelding that will go anywhere you point, this is him! He loads and unloads, backing out. He’s clean legged and built right. I cannot say anything bad about this gelding!
